Life magazine called Borgnines characterization of the lonely butcher who falls in love with an equally plain and lonely schoolteacher (played by Betsy Blair) one of the most successful pieces of movie casting so far this year., New York Times film critic Bosley Crowther wrote that Borgnines Oscar-winning performance was a beautiful blend of the crude and the strangely gentle and sensitive in a monosyllabic man., In the wake of Marty, Borgnine played an Amish farmer in Violent Saturday, a prizefight promoter in The Square Jungle, a rancher in Jubal and a Bronx taxi driver (opposite Bette Davis) in The Catered Affair.. He wrote in his autobiography, Ernie (Citadel Press, 2008), that he had turned down the role because he refused to do a television series but changed his mind when a boy came to his door selling candy and said, although he knew who James Arness of Gunsmoke and Richard Boone of Have Gun, Will Travel were, he had never heard of Ernest Borgnine. In a film career that began in 1951, Borgnine appeared in more than 115 movies, including Johnny Guitar, Demetrius and the Gladiators, The Flight of the Phoenix, The Oscar, The Dirty Dozen,""The Wild Bunch,""Willard, The Poseidon Adventure and Emperor of the North..
